When the tenancy ends, a tenant can take any trade fixture
A. that she attached during her tenancy before she leaves. |
||
B. that was present during her tenancy. |
||
C. that he used during his tenancy. |
||
D. that he attached during his tenancy, within two weeks of the end of the tenancy. |
||
E. that she wants. |
Answer:
Trade fixtures are additional property of the tenants but not the land lords. Trade fixtures can be any sort of items like machinery used in household or business purposes etc. The authority of such fixtures lies in the hands of tenants but not landlords. The landlords have the authority only on the real property. hence, the answer is
A. that she attached during her tenancy before she leaves.
